pgsql windows 安装
时间: 2025-01-17 09:03:04 浏览: 54
### 如何在 Windows 上安装 PostgreSQL 数据库
#### 准备工作
确保计算机已连接到互联网以便下载必要的文件。关闭任何可能干扰安装过程的应用程序。
#### 下载安装包
访问官方网站或可信资源获取最新版本的PostgreSQL安装文件[^1]。通常可以从官方页面找到适用于不同操作系统的链接,选择适合Windows环境的那一项并启动下载流程。
#### 执行安装向导
双击运行所下载下来的.exe可执行文件来开启图形化界面指导下的设置进程。按照提示逐步前进,在此期间会遇到关于目标路径设定、组件选取以及服务配置等方面的选择机会,请依据个人需求做出相应调整[^2]。
#### 配置初始化选项
当被询问至创建超级用户账号及其密码时务必牢记输入的信息;另外对于编码方式一般推荐采用UTF8以支持更广泛字符集处理能力。同时注意端口号默认为5432除非有特殊理由否则不建议更改以免引起后续连通性问题[^3]。
#### 启动与验证
完成上述步骤之后,默认情况下PostgreSQL的服务会被自动激活。可以通过命令行工具`psql -U postgres`尝试登录测试是否成功建立连接,并利用SQL语句查询当前服务器状态来进行简单检验。
```sql
SELECT version();
```
相关问题
安装pgsql windows
要在 Windows 上安装 PostgreSQL,可以按照以下步骤进行操作:
1. 访问 PostgreSQL 官方网站:https://www.postgresql.org/download/windows/
2. 在页面上找到 "Interactive installer by BigSQL" 部分,选择最新版本的 Windows 安装程序。
3. 下载安装程序并运行它。根据提示选择安装类型、安装位置和其他选项。
4. 在 "Select Components" 页面上,选择要安装的组件。通常情况下,建议选择 "Installation Stack Builder" 和 "pgAdmin"。
5. 在 "Select Data Directory" 页面上,选择数据库文件的存储位置。默认情况下,建议将其保留为默认设置。
6. 在 "Select Service Account" 页面上,选择用于运行 PostgreSQL 服务的帐户。建议选择 "NT AUTHORITY\NetworkService"。
7. 在 "Password for PostgreSQL Superuser" 页面上,设置超级用户的密码。请确保记住此密码,因为它将用于管理 PostgreSQL。
8. 在 "Port Configuration" 页面上,选择要使用的端口号。默认情况下,建议使用默认端口号。
9. 在 "Ready to Install" 页面上,检查所选的配置并单击 "Next" 开始安装。
10. 安装完成后,您可以选择启动 pgAdmin,它是一个 PostgreSQL 数据库管理工具,可帮助您管理数据库和执行查询。
完成上述步骤后,您应该成功地在 Windows 上安装了 PostgreSQL 数据库。您可以使用 pgAdmin 或其他客户端工具连接到数据库,并开始使用它。
pgsql windows
<think>好的,我需要帮助用户解决在Windows上安装和配置PostgreSQL的问题。首先,我得回顾用户提供的引用内容,看看是否有相关的步骤或资源可用。
根据引用[1]、[2]、[3],用户提到的都是关于在Windows上安装PostgreSQL的不同资源。引用[1]提到了安装步骤的详细指导,引用[2]提供了14.4-1版本的下载链接,而引用[3]则指向了官网的下载地址。需要注意的是,引用[2]的链接可能不是最新版本,所以可能需要建议用户优先访问官网获取最新版本,同时也要注意安全,避免从不可信的来源下载。
接下来,我需要整理出一个清晰的安装流程。通常安装PostgreSQL的步骤包括下载安装程序、运行安装向导、配置安装路径、设置超级用户密码、选择端口、选择默认数据库等。配置部分可能包括设置环境变量、初始化数据库、启动服务以及验证安装是否成功。
需要注意用户可能遇到的问题,比如端口冲突(默认5432)、服务无法启动、密码忘记等。此外,安装后的基本配置如创建新用户、数据库,以及远程访问的设置可能也是用户需要的,但用户的问题主要集中在安装和配置,所以可能需要简要提及这些后续步骤。
用户提到的引用中有不同的下载链接,需要指出官网是最可靠的来源,并建议用户从引用[3]提供的地址下载。同时,安装过程中可能需要选择组件,比如Stack Builder,用于安装附加工具,但根据用户的需求,可能不需要详细展开这部分,除非用户特别问到。
在编写步骤时,需要分点说明,确保清晰易懂。例如,第一步下载安装程序,第二步运行安装向导,设置密码和端口,第三步完成安装并启动服务。配置部分可能需要包括如何连接数据库,使用pgAdmin或者psql命令行工具。
此外,用户可能对配置环境变量有疑问,因为在安装过程中通常会自动添加,但有时候需要手动检查。还需要提醒用户注意防火墙设置,如果遇到连接问题,可能需要开放相应端口。
最后,生成的相关问题需要围绕安装后的配置、常见问题解决、版本差异等,帮助用户进一步了解可能需要的后续步骤或问题排查。</think>### Windows 上安装和配置 PostgreSQL 的步骤
#### 1. **下载安装程序**
- 访问 PostgreSQL 官网下载页面:[PostgreSQL 下载地址](https://www.enterprisedb.com/downloads/postgres-postgresql-downloads)(引用[^3]),选择适合的 Windows 版本(如 14.4-1)。
- 若需直接下载旧版本,可通过引用[^2]中的链接获取,但建议优先使用官网最新版本以确保安全性。
#### 2. **运行安装向导**
- 双击下载的 `.exe` 文件启动安装程序。
- **关键步骤**:
1. 选择安装路径(默认 `C:\Program Files\PostgreSQL`)。
2. 设置超级用户(`postgres`)的密码(需牢记,后续登录需使用)。
3. 选择端口号(默认为 `5432`,若冲突可修改)。
4. 选择默认数据库语言(通常选 `PostgreSQL` 推荐的配置)。
#### 3. **安装组件**
- 勾选 **Stack Builder**(用于安装图形化管理工具 pgAdmin)和其他所需工具(如命令行工具 `psql`)。
#### 4. **完成安装并启动服务**
- 安装完成后,PostgreSQL 服务会自动启动。可通过以下方式验证:
- 打开 **pgAdmin**(安装时默认包含),连接到本地服务器。
- 使用命令行工具 `psql -U postgres -h localhost` 输入密码登录。
#### 5. **环境变量配置(可选)**
- 若需在命令行中直接使用 `psql`,需将 `PostgreSQL\bin` 目录添加到系统环境变量 `PATH` 中(通常安装程序会自动添加)。
---
### 配置 PostgreSQL
1. **修改配置文件**
- 配置文件位于安装目录下的 `data` 文件夹(如 `C:\Program Files\PostgreSQL\14\data`)。
- 编辑 `postgresql.conf` 可调整端口、监听地址等。
- 编辑 `pg_hba.conf` 可配置客户端访问权限(如允许远程连接)。
2. **创建用户和数据库**
- 使用 pgAdmin 或命令行:
```sql
CREATE USER myuser WITH PASSWORD 'mypassword';
CREATE DATABASE mydb OWNER myuser;
```
3. **远程访问配置(如需)**
- 在 `postgresql.conf` 中设置 `listen_addresses = '*'`。
- 在 `pg_hba.conf` 中添加规则:
```
host all all 0.0.0.0/0 scram-sha-256
```
- 重启服务使配置生效。
---
### 常见问题解决
- **端口冲突**:若默认端口 `5432` 被占用,安装时需修改为其他端口(如 `5433`)。
- **服务无法启动**:检查日志文件(`data\pg_log`)排查错误,常见原因为权限或端口问题。
- **忘记密码**:可通过修改 `pg_hba.conf` 暂时允许无密码登录,再通过 `psql` 重置密码[^1]。
---
阅读全文
相关推荐
















